Can GeForce GTX 1660 SUPER run Secret Files 3?

Great

The GeForce GTX 1660 SUPER handles Secret Files 3 well at 1080p, delivering approximately 648 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 486 FPS.

Minimum System Requirements

CPU
Pentium® IV 2 Ghz Single Core or 100 % compatible Processor
GPU
DirectX® 9-compatible Graphicard with min. 128 MB memory
RAM
1 GB

About

Secret Files 3, released in 2012, is a captivating adventure game that blends storytelling with intricate puzzle-solving set across various timelines. Players navigate through both past and future scenarios, making choices that lead to different endings, thus enhancing its replayability. The game's engaging narrative and unique mechanics set it apart in the adventure genre.

In terms of PC performance, Secret Files 3 is quite accessible, as it requires only an entry-level GPU with a minimum score of around 100 to run smoothly. With a minimum RAM requirement of just 1 GB, the game can deliver a satisfactory FPS even on modest hardware. Players can expect good performance on lower-end systems, though utilizing a mid-tier GPU will allow for improved visuals and gameplay fluidity.
